
About gulfHR
GulfHR is an easy to use, cloud-based Human Resources management solution built to help companies manage their HR processes and deliver better service to employees. Whether the company need to improve the recruitment or payroll processes, or simply track employees' time and attendance, GulfHR offers the tools required for a successful HRMS implementation.

GulfHR Feedback
Reviewed on 03/07/2023
We are only using it for payroll prospective as we have a different data management system so the...
We are only using it for payroll prospective as we have a different data management system so the feed back is only regarding the payroll system
Pros
I like the customer service. They always respond very quickly and try to solve the issues in a timely manner.
Cons
There is still a lot of manual work and the process can be tedious sometimes. For example if I create a new employee the gratuity filter has to be then manually changed as this is not there in the standard setup. To create a new employee you will first create a job master, then create organizational structure and then link the employee. It is the same for promotions and transfers. Many times when I have salary increments I have faced errors in the back pay if gosi is involved. We have many regions but i can only download bulk payroll file with all regions so I again have to download it and seperate it to different regions. So this has manual work too. These are small things that they can improve to make the system more effective
